Factors to Consider When Choosing Fall Detection Wearables
When choosing fall detection wearables, you’ll want to think about several key factors. Comfort and fit are essential since you’ll be wearing the device regularly. Additionally, consider monitoring capabilities, communication options, battery life, and any subscription fees that may apply.
Device Comfort and Fit
Choosing a fall detection wearable that fits comfortably is vital, especially since you want to guarantee it’s something you’ll actually wear. For seniors, tight or heavy devices can lead to irritation, so look for lightweight designs made from soft materials like silicone. An adjustable fit is important; it makes sure the device stays secure on your wrist without restricting blood circulation. Opt for devices with a slim profile that blend seamlessly with your personal style, allowing you to wear them discreetly. Additionally, consider models with waterproof features, so you can wear them during various activities, including bathing or swimming, without worrying about damage. Prioritizing comfort and fit makes it easier to incorporate these wearables into your daily life.

Battery Life Considerations
When considering fall detection wearables, battery life is fundamental for guaranteeing reliable, continuous monitoring. Many devices offer between 3 to 8 days of use on a single charge, which impacts their effectiveness. A shorter battery life may require more frequent charging, risking lapses in wearability and delaying emergency responses. Look for wearables with energy-efficient designs or low-power modes that extend battery life without losing functionality. Ease of recharging is also important; some devices come with convenient docking stations, while others might need cumbersome plug-in methods. Regular battery maintenance and monitoring are essential to keep your device operational and ready for use in emergencies. Prioritizing battery life helps guarantee peace of mind and safety.
Subscription Costs and Fees
Choosing a fall detection wearable often involves weighing subscription costs and fees, which can greatly impact your budget. Monthly fees typically range from $24.95 to $40, depending on service levels and features. Some devices even offer a free first month, letting you test the system before committing. It’s essential to watch for any extra activation or hidden fees, as these can add to your expenses. Make sure the subscription covers important features like 24/7 monitoring, emergency alerts, and GPS tracking, as these improve overall safety. Alternatively, consider devices that don’t require mandatory monthly fees for core functions, providing a cost-effective option for those who want to avoid ongoing expenses.

Waterproof and Durability Ratings
Selecting a fall detection wearable that’s both waterproof and durable is vital for ensuring it withstands everyday challenges. Look for devices with an IP67 rating, meaning they can handle immersion in water up to 1 meter for 30 minutes, making them perfect for showering or light rain. Durability often stems from high-quality, impact-resistant materials, providing better protection against drops and wear. Consider comfort too; lightweight wearables with soft straps encourage consistent use, especially for seniors. Battery life plays an important role as well; a device lasting several days on a single charge is more practical. Finally, a rugged design enhances longevity, particularly if the wearable faces rough handling or harsh environments.
GPS Tracking Accuracy
Accurate GPS tracking is essential for fall detection wearables, ensuring you can rely on real-time location data during emergencies. When choosing a device, look for high-quality GPS systems that offer location accuracy within 5 to 10 meters. This precision allows caregivers to quickly pinpoint your location if you need help. Advanced systems often combine technologies like AGPS and LBS to improve tracking accuracy in various environments. Additionally, consider how frequently the device updates your location; some wearables refresh every few seconds, while others may take a minute or more. Faster updates can greatly enhance emergency response times, often reducing them to under 10 seconds in well-monitored systems. Prioritize these features for ideal safety and security.
